    Lansdell: Bigger drop of the ball by Vince: Matt Morgan or Rhino?
    Short: That's kind of a toss up, but I'd say Rhino. I'm not completely sold on Morgan yet.
    Lansdell: Yes, but Rhino had more success in WWE than Morgan.
    Short: Morgan was screwed on day one with the stuttering gimmick. They say a good worker can get any gimmick over, but I have no idea how that would work.
    Lansdell: I don't agree that a good worker can get anything over. Look at the Red Rooster. For the counter-argument, look at Eugene. Still, Morgan was green when he got that gimmick, and didn't have the experience to make it work. This is Vince's problem with big guys – he rushes them up and saddles them with a gimmick that they're just not ready to handle. Mordecai, Stuttering Matt Morgan, Fake Kane, Not My Fault Snitsky…

    Final Thoughts

    Short: This was a great go-home show for the PPV this Sunday. Every match got a bit of time to sell itself and watching this show makes me want to actually buy this PPV. The matches were as short as they usually are, but the promos were all on this week. Rhino was the MVP of the show, as he really showed he's got more mic skills than screaming "GOOOOOOOORE!" The Sarah Palin stuff flat out sucked, but that was never going to work in the first place. Fine show this week, could have used more wrestling, and I'm done.

    Lansdell: The time has finally come for me to stop expecting the worst from every TNA segment. The past few weeks have delivered more than disappointed, and even matches which I would expect to suck royally have surprised me. That was this week's them for me: better than I expected. Blood in the main event, some funny segments, some serious promos, story development and enough PPV hype that I actually care about a couple of matches that I didn't care about last week. I still expect a Team 3D swerve at the PPV, as the final major win for the Main Event Mafia before they start losing at Genesis (even the PPV name fits). The thing is, this swerve will work because I don't think it's as obvious as most TNA swerves. Rhino continues to impress, the young guys are starting to shine through, and all is right with an angle that almost everyone said TNA couldn't do. I'd just like to point out that I always thought it could be done well. Not to gloat, of course. The Beer Money/Morgan and Abyss feud is an interesting one, although I really don't want Beer Money losing the belts to those two. I can see it happening unfortunately, if only to transition the straps to Team 3D when they join the MEM. The less said about the Palin segments, the better. For me, they almost ruined a very good show. Less of that please, TNA. Overall though a strong show that did what it needed to: make people want the pay per view.
